Louvred Pergolas and App-Controlled Convenience

One of the most exciting developments in outdoor automation involves louvred pergolas. These structures feature adjustable roof slats that open or close to control sunlight and airflow. Homeowners can now manage those slats directly from a smartphone app, eliminating the need to crank or adjust them manually. The benefits of adding a louvred pergola to your living space extend beyond aesthetics. You gain real functional control over your outdoor climate without stepping away from what you’re doing.

Modern louvred pergolas integrate with platforms like Google Home or Amazon Alexa, allowing you to pair voice commands with app controls for greater flexibility. Some models include built-in weather sensors that automatically adjust the louvres when rain or strong wind kicks in. Your pergola essentially responds to its environment, and your phone keeps you informed every step of the way.

Advanced Lighting That Responds to Your Schedule

Outdoor lighting has come a long way from simple timers and manual switches. Advanced lighting systems now sync with your phone’s GPS, so your backyard lights turn on automatically as you pull into the driveway. You can design custom schedules and fine-tune your lighting through the app, giving you total control without ever flipping a physical switch.

Many advanced lighting setups connect with other outdoor devices to create a unified ecosystem. Your lights can dim when your outdoor speakers activate or brighten when your security cameras detect motion. That level of coordination turns your backyard into a responsive space that fits into your lifestyle rather than the other way around. App-Controlled Irrigation for a Healthier Yard

Watering the lawn used to mean dragging hoses or wrestling with clunky mechanical timers. App-controlled irrigation systems have replaced that process with something far more intuitive. These systems connect to your phone and pull data from local weather forecasts to automatically adjust watering schedules. If rain is forecast, the system skips the scheduled cycle and conserves water without your input.

You can also control specific zones manually through the app and review your water usage over time. Some systems generate detailed reports that show exactly how much water each zone consumes throughout the week. For homeowners who care about conservation and lawn health, that level of insight is genuinely useful.

Security and Monitoring From the Palm of Your Hand

Outdoor security has always mattered, but mobile integration makes it more accessible to the average homeowner. Intelligent cameras and motion-sensing devices now feed live video directly to your phone, so you can check on your backyard from anywhere and receive instant alerts when a sensor is triggered.

Some systems even let you set up custom alert zones, so you only receive notifications for activity in specific areas of your property. That kind of targeted monitoring reduces unnecessary alerts and keeps your attention focused on what matters.

Many of these systems also include two-way audio, so you can communicate with a delivery person or a neighbour without stepping outside. The ability to monitor and respond to outdoor activity in real time gives homeowners greater control than with older systems.

Choosing the Right Ecosystem for Your Setup

With so many app-based outdoor products available, picking the right ecosystem matters more than you’d think. Most devices are compatible with established smart home platforms like Google Home and Amazon Alexa. Choosing a platform early and sticking with it keeps everything connected and manageable through a single app. That consistency saves you from future compatibility headaches.

Compatibility is the biggest factor to consider before buying a new outdoor device. A pergola that doesn’t sync with your existing irrigation app creates friction rather than convenience. Researching compatibility upfront saves you time and helps you build a system that functions as you expect.
